Why not buy them from jewellery stores like Chow Tai Fok or Chow Sang Sang? They sell physical bullion in 1 tael (37,5g). The only catch is you must sell the bullion back to the same company (regardless of branch) in order to get their buy in price. That's because they have their store name engraved on them. But gold is gold. The difference between most jewellery store's selling and buy in price is fixed at $300. All the stores sell gold bullion coins at the same price in Hong Kong.
